The form of a working shoe’s heel isn’t simply an aesthetic selection—it could additionally impression your stride and the way properly the shoe absorbs impression as you run. Together with new foam and a softer, extra cushioned tongue, the Bondi 8’s new, bigger heel and crash pad are supposed to present a comfortable, easy experience.

There’s no getting round it: The Bondi 8 will look chunky in your ft—which lots of people love—but when that’s not your private choice, it’s one thing to contemplate. This was really one of many elements that made me hesitate so lengthy within the first place, however now that they’re on my ft nearly day by day (and I don’t journey or stumble round in them because of the thick sole, like I used to be afraid of), I’m glad I took the plunge. If something, the peak of the heel makes it really feel like there’s one thing extra substantial beneath my ft.

What I discovered most spectacular was that, regardless of how cumbersome the shoe seems to be, it feels shockingly light-weight—which is sensible since they clock in at 8.9 ounces, the Bondi 8 is considerably lighter than my Adidas’s Stan Smith’s (my previous standbys), which weigh round 11 ounces.

I’m not the one fan of the redesign: With over 6,000 five-star critiques on Hoka’s web site, the Bondi 8 has loads of different admirers. Even the American Podiatric Medical Affiliation has seen—the group awarded this sneaker their seal of acceptance, that means a gaggle of specialists has decided that it helps promote higher foot well being.

Board-certified podiatrist Julie Schottenstein, MS, DPM, tells SELF that she recommends the Bondi 8 to her sufferers on a regular basis—notably individuals with excessive arches, because of the shoe’s ultra-plush cushioning. These sneakers have a stack peak of about 50 millimeters on the heel and a heel-to-toe drop of 4 millimeters, that means there’s over 1.5 inches of sentimental foam all through your complete footbed to soak up shock as you stroll or run.

“Cushion is at all times the secret for sufferers with excessive arches, and the Bondi 8 actually does this properly,” Dr. Schottenstein says. “Moreover, this shoe could be nice for sufferers with situations like metatarsalgia [a condition marked by pain in the ball of your feet] and likewise older sufferers who’ve misplaced the fats pad on their foot, which might happen with regular ageing.”

Match and really feel

After I first laced them up, it was apparent that there’s a ton of padding within the Bondi 8. My ft felt like they had been resting on a agency pillow. (And as an added bonus, they made this quick particular person really feel an inch taller.) The tongue itself is further cushioned and comfortable in opposition to my foot—that is clearly a shoe designed for final consolation.

I acquired them within the common width, and though my ft are on the broader facet, they’ve by no means felt tight or constricting. Involved about pinched toes? You might wish to spring for the broad width—simply be aware that there are fewer shade choices to select from.
